Sondre Lerche - Neuromantics

June 3, 2023

Photos: Thor Brødreskift

Lerche brings a stellar team with him to Store Scene at Den Nationale Scene. Harpist Mary Lattimore and violinist and film composer Tim Fain are both from the US. Lerche also brings in his musical partners, Alexander von Mehren on keys, as well as long-term collaborators Kato Ådland and Jørgen Træen. The Bergen based choir Volve Vokal will join them on stage.

The choir also joined Lerche last year as he performed three concerts on the three floors of Kulturhuset, to outstanding reviews. 

Due to popular demand, a second performance has been added on Saturday 3 June at 21:30.
